Konfigurieren von Tomcat für MySQL-Konnektivität
MySQL-Connector-Platzierung
Der Speicherort des JDBC-Treibers für MySQL, mysql-connector-java-5.1.13-bin, hängt von der Verbindungsverwaltung ab Methode.
-
JNDI-Datenquelle: Platzieren Sie die JAR-Datei in Tomcat/lib. Dadurch kann Tomcat Verbindungen verwalten und auf den Treiber zugreifen.
-
DriverManager-Methode: Platzieren Sie die JAR-Datei entweder in Tomcat/lib (globaler Zugriff) oder YourApp/WEB-INF/lib (per- Webapp-Überschreibung).
Konfiguration Dateien
-
JNDI-Datenquelle:
- Konfigurieren Sie die Datenquelle in YourApp/META-INF/context.xml.
- Verweisen Sie mit a auf die Datenquelle in YourApp/WEB-INF/web.xml resources-env-ref.
-
DriverManager-Methode:
- Konfigurieren Sie die Verbindungsparameter manuell. Keine Tomcat-Konfiguration erforderlich.
Web.XML-Datei
Eine web.xml-Datei ist erforderlich, um Webanwendungskomponenten wie z als Servlets, Filter und Listener. Platzieren Sie es unter Tomcat 6.0webappsmyappWEB-INF.
Ressourcen
- [DAO Tutorial](https://www.javenue.info/post/java/dao-tutorial-basic-jdbcdao-tutorial-targeted-on-tomcatjspservlet)
- [JDBC-Datenbankverbindung in Servlets](https://stackoverflow.com/questions/2402574/how-should-i-connect-to-jdbc-database-datasource-in-a-servlet-based-application)
- [JDBC-Treiber Platzierung für Tomcat Pool](https://stackoverflow.com/questions/5655929/where-do-i-have-to-place-the-jdbc-driver-for-tomcats-connection-pool)
Das obige ist der detaillierte Inhalt vonWie konfiguriere ich Tomcat für MySQL-Datenbankkonnektivität mithilfe von JNDI oder DriverManager?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!